The Strategic Division (SD) supports high-reliability organizations including Navy Strategic Systems Programs (SSP), Air Force Nuclear Weapons Center, and the Department of Energy (DOE), among others. Our support across our client base is expanding rapidly and encompasses important services, such as data analytics and visualization, threat analysis, risk management, modeling and simulation, cost estimating, earned value management, program management, system engineering, independent evaluation, and High Consequence Event prevention.

SPA has an immediate need for a Data Management Program Manager to support the on-site SPA team at Hill AFB, UT. The Sentinel Intercontinental Ballistic Missile Group (SIG) supports the Air Force Nuclear Weapons Center in the acquisition of the LGM-35A Sentinel (GBSD) ICBM weapon system. SIG delivers program management, systems engineering, and subject matter expertise to ensure on-time delivery of a safe, secure, and reliable strategic nuclear weapon system.

Responsibilities

SPA is seeking an exceptional Program Manager for an exciting opportunity to support the Air Force Nuclear Weapons Center (AFNWC) Sentinel Systems Directorate in the acquisition of the next generation Intercontinental Ballistic Missile (ICBM), which provides strategic deterrent capability to our Nation. The program manager will work with a highly skilled team while providing planning, scheduling and support to the government customer for major program integration & execution activities. Candidate will oversee different Data Management initiatives, monitor progress and ensure completion within deadlines. Candidate will provide Sentinel directorate support in the daily use of data systems and assist with data extraction and reports as needed. Candidate will operate in an organizational culture that develops and challenges employees to achieve high performance in a fast-paced, high-morale workplace using streamlined management policies and procedures. Day to day activitives may include: Product lifecycle management, CM/DM and CDRL oversight, contract execution management, contractor incentives management, affordability and life cycle cost reduction, IPMDAR & control account reviews, PMRs, and government furnished property coordination, RFI and CRM resolution.
